Skip to content

Commit a243611

Browse files
committed
more isort
1 parent a87360d commit a243611

14 files changed

+86
-123
lines changed

.isort.cfg

Lines changed: 0 additions & 5 deletions
This file was deleted.

tests/invalid_ecdh.py

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,6 @@
11
import pytest
22

3-
from cryptojwt.jwe import JWE_EC
4-
from cryptojwt.jwe import factory
3+
from cryptojwt.jwe import JWE_EC, factory
54
from cryptojwt.jwk import ECKey
65

76
JWK = {

tests/test_02_jwk.py

Lines changed: 30 additions & 29 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,4 @@
11
#!/usr/bin/env python3
2-
32
from __future__ import print_function
43

54
import base64
@@ -13,34 +12,36 @@
1312
from cryptography.hazmat.primitives.asymmetric import rsa
1413
from cryptography.hazmat.primitives.asymmetric.ec import generate_private_key
1514

16-
from cryptojwt.exception import DeSerializationNotPossible
17-
from cryptojwt.exception import UnsupportedAlgorithm
18-
from cryptojwt.exception import WrongUsage
19-
from cryptojwt.jwk import JWK
20-
from cryptojwt.jwk import calculate_x5t
21-
from cryptojwt.jwk import certificate_fingerprint
22-
from cryptojwt.jwk import pem_hash
23-
from cryptojwt.jwk import pems_to_x5c
24-
from cryptojwt.jwk.ec import NIST2SEC
25-
from cryptojwt.jwk.ec import ECKey
26-
from cryptojwt.jwk.hmac import SYMKey
27-
from cryptojwt.jwk.hmac import new_sym_key
28-
from cryptojwt.jwk.hmac import sha256_digest
29-
from cryptojwt.jwk.jwk import dump_jwk
30-
from cryptojwt.jwk.jwk import import_jwk
31-
from cryptojwt.jwk.jwk import jwk_wrap
32-
from cryptojwt.jwk.jwk import key_from_jwk_dict
33-
from cryptojwt.jwk.rsa import RSAKey
34-
from cryptojwt.jwk.rsa import import_private_rsa_key_from_file
35-
from cryptojwt.jwk.rsa import import_public_rsa_key_from_file
36-
from cryptojwt.jwk.rsa import import_rsa_key_from_cert_file
37-
from cryptojwt.jwk.rsa import new_rsa_key
38-
from cryptojwt.utils import as_bytes
39-
from cryptojwt.utils import as_unicode
40-
from cryptojwt.utils import b64e
41-
from cryptojwt.utils import base64_to_long
42-
from cryptojwt.utils import base64url_to_long
43-
from cryptojwt.utils import long2intarr
15+
from cryptojwt.exception import (
16+
DeSerializationNotPossible,
17+
UnsupportedAlgorithm,
18+
WrongUsage,
19+
)
20+
from cryptojwt.jwk import (
21+
JWK,
22+
calculate_x5t,
23+
certificate_fingerprint,
24+
pem_hash,
25+
pems_to_x5c,
26+
)
27+
from cryptojwt.jwk.ec import NIST2SEC, ECKey
28+
from cryptojwt.jwk.hmac import SYMKey, new_sym_key, sha256_digest
29+
from cryptojwt.jwk.jwk import dump_jwk, import_jwk, jwk_wrap, key_from_jwk_dict
30+
from cryptojwt.jwk.rsa import (
31+
RSAKey,
32+
import_private_rsa_key_from_file,
33+
import_public_rsa_key_from_file,
34+
import_rsa_key_from_cert_file,
35+
new_rsa_key,
36+
)
37+
from cryptojwt.utils import (
38+
as_bytes,
39+
as_unicode,
40+
b64e,
41+
base64_to_long,
42+
base64url_to_long,
43+
long2intarr,
44+
)
4445

4546
__author__ = "Roland Hedberg"
4647
BASEDIR = os.path.abspath(os.path.dirname(__file__))

tests/test_03_key_bundle.py

Lines changed: 15 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-10,23 +10,22 @@
1010
import responses
1111
from cryptography.hazmat.primitives.asymmetric import rsa
1212

13-
from cryptojwt.jwk.ec import ECKey
14-
from cryptojwt.jwk.ec import new_ec_key
13+
from cryptojwt.jwk.ec import ECKey, new_ec_key
1514
from cryptojwt.jwk.hmac import SYMKey
16-
from cryptojwt.jwk.rsa import RSAKey
17-
from cryptojwt.jwk.rsa import import_rsa_key_from_cert_file
18-
from cryptojwt.jwk.rsa import new_rsa_key
19-
from cryptojwt.key_bundle import KeyBundle
20-
from cryptojwt.key_bundle import build_key_bundle
21-
from cryptojwt.key_bundle import dump_jwks
22-
from cryptojwt.key_bundle import init_key
23-
from cryptojwt.key_bundle import key_diff
24-
from cryptojwt.key_bundle import key_gen
25-
from cryptojwt.key_bundle import key_rollover
26-
from cryptojwt.key_bundle import keybundle_from_local_file
27-
from cryptojwt.key_bundle import rsa_init
28-
from cryptojwt.key_bundle import unique_keys
29-
from cryptojwt.key_bundle import update_key_bundle
15+
from cryptojwt.jwk.rsa import RSAKey, import_rsa_key_from_cert_file, new_rsa_key
16+
from cryptojwt.key_bundle import (
17+
KeyBundle,
18+
build_key_bundle,
19+
dump_jwks,
20+
init_key,
21+
key_diff,
22+
key_gen,
23+
key_rollover,
24+
keybundle_from_local_file,
25+
rsa_init,
26+
unique_keys,
27+
update_key_bundle,
28+
)
3029

3130
__author__ = "Roland Hedberg"
3231

tests/test_04_key_issuer.py

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-7,11 +7,8 @@
77

88
from cryptojwt.exception import JWKESTException
99
from cryptojwt.jwk.hmac import SYMKey
10-
from cryptojwt.key_bundle import KeyBundle
11-
from cryptojwt.key_bundle import keybundle_from_local_file
12-
from cryptojwt.key_issuer import KeyIssuer
13-
from cryptojwt.key_issuer import build_keyissuer
14-
from cryptojwt.key_issuer import init_key_issuer
10+
from cryptojwt.key_bundle import KeyBundle, keybundle_from_local_file
11+
from cryptojwt.key_issuer import KeyIssuer, build_keyissuer, init_key_issuer
1512

1613
__author__ = "Roland Hedberg"
1714

tests/test_04_key_jar.py

Lines changed: 4 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-5,18 +5,11 @@
55

66
import pytest
77

8-
from cryptojwt.exception import IssuerNotFound
9-
from cryptojwt.exception import JWKESTException
8+
from cryptojwt.exception import IssuerNotFound, JWKESTException
109
from cryptojwt.jwe.jwenc import JWEnc
11-
from cryptojwt.jws.jws import JWS
12-
from cryptojwt.jws.jws import factory
13-
from cryptojwt.key_bundle import KeyBundle
14-
from cryptojwt.key_bundle import keybundle_from_local_file
15-
from cryptojwt.key_bundle import rsa_init
16-
from cryptojwt.key_jar import KeyJar
17-
from cryptojwt.key_jar import build_keyjar
18-
from cryptojwt.key_jar import init_key_jar
19-
from cryptojwt.key_jar import rotate_keys
10+
from cryptojwt.jws.jws import JWS, factory
11+
from cryptojwt.key_bundle import KeyBundle, keybundle_from_local_file, rsa_init
12+
from cryptojwt.key_jar import KeyJar, build_keyjar, init_key_jar, rotate_keys
2013

2114
__author__ = "Roland Hedberg"
2215

tests/test_06_jws.py

Lines changed: 6 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-7,28 +7,16 @@
77
from cryptography.hazmat.backends import default_backend
88
from cryptography.hazmat.primitives.asymmetric import ec
99

10-
from cryptojwt.exception import BadSignature
11-
from cryptojwt.exception import UnknownAlgorithm
12-
from cryptojwt.exception import WrongNumberOfParts
10+
from cryptojwt.exception import BadSignature, UnknownAlgorithm, WrongNumberOfParts
1311
from cryptojwt.jwk.ec import ECKey
1412
from cryptojwt.jwk.hmac import SYMKey
15-
from cryptojwt.jwk.rsa import RSAKey
16-
from cryptojwt.jwk.rsa import import_private_rsa_key_from_file
17-
from cryptojwt.jws.exception import FormatError
18-
from cryptojwt.jws.exception import NoSuitableSigningKeys
19-
from cryptojwt.jws.exception import SignerAlgError
20-
from cryptojwt.jws.jws import JWS
21-
from cryptojwt.jws.jws import SIGNER_ALGS
22-
from cryptojwt.jws.jws import JWSig
23-
from cryptojwt.jws.jws import factory
13+
from cryptojwt.jwk.rsa import RSAKey, import_private_rsa_key_from_file
14+
from cryptojwt.jws.exception import FormatError, NoSuitableSigningKeys, SignerAlgError
15+
from cryptojwt.jws.jws import JWS, SIGNER_ALGS, JWSig, factory
2416
from cryptojwt.jws.rsa import RSASigner
25-
from cryptojwt.jws.utils import left_hash
26-
from cryptojwt.jws.utils import parse_rsa_algorithm
17+
from cryptojwt.jws.utils import left_hash, parse_rsa_algorithm
2718
from cryptojwt.key_bundle import KeyBundle
28-
from cryptojwt.utils import b64d
29-
from cryptojwt.utils import b64d_enc_dec
30-
from cryptojwt.utils import b64e
31-
from cryptojwt.utils import intarr2bin
19+
from cryptojwt.utils import b64d, b64d_enc_dec, b64e, intarr2bin
3220

3321
BASEDIR = os.path.abspath(os.path.dirname(__file__))
3422

tests/test_07_jwe.py

Lines changed: 18 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-9,34 +9,34 @@
99
from cryptography.hazmat.backends import default_backend
1010
from cryptography.hazmat.primitives.asymmetric import ec
1111

12-
from cryptojwt.exception import BadSyntax
13-
from cryptojwt.exception import HeaderError
14-
from cryptojwt.exception import MissingKey
15-
from cryptojwt.exception import Unsupported
16-
from cryptojwt.exception import VerificationError
17-
from cryptojwt.jwe.aes import AES_CBCEncrypter
18-
from cryptojwt.jwe.aes import AES_GCMEncrypter
19-
from cryptojwt.jwe.exception import NoSuitableDecryptionKey
20-
from cryptojwt.jwe.exception import NoSuitableEncryptionKey
21-
from cryptojwt.jwe.exception import UnsupportedBitLength
22-
from cryptojwt.jwe.exception import WrongEncryptionAlgorithm
23-
from cryptojwt.jwe.jwe import JWE
24-
from cryptojwt.jwe.jwe import factory
12+
from cryptojwt.exception import (
13+
BadSyntax,
14+
HeaderError,
15+
MissingKey,
16+
Unsupported,
17+
VerificationError,
18+
)
19+
from cryptojwt.jwe.aes import AES_CBCEncrypter, AES_GCMEncrypter
20+
from cryptojwt.jwe.exception import (
21+
NoSuitableDecryptionKey,
22+
NoSuitableEncryptionKey,
23+
UnsupportedBitLength,
24+
WrongEncryptionAlgorithm,
25+
)
26+
from cryptojwt.jwe.jwe import JWE, factory
2527
from cryptojwt.jwe.jwe_ec import JWE_EC
2628
from cryptojwt.jwe.jwe_hmac import JWE_SYM
2729
from cryptojwt.jwe.jwe_rsa import JWE_RSA
2830
from cryptojwt.jwe.utils import split_ctx_and_tag
2931
from cryptojwt.jwk.ec import ECKey
3032
from cryptojwt.jwk.hmac import SYMKey
31-
from cryptojwt.jwk.rsa import RSAKey
32-
from cryptojwt.jwk.rsa import import_private_rsa_key_from_file
33-
from cryptojwt.utils import as_bytes
34-
from cryptojwt.utils import b64e
33+
from cryptojwt.jwk.rsa import RSAKey, import_private_rsa_key_from_file
34+
from cryptojwt.utils import as_bytes, b64e
3535

3636
__author__ = "rohe0002"
3737

3838
try:
39-
import random.SystemRandom as rnd
39+
from random import SystemRandom as rnd
4040
except ImportError:
4141
import random as rnd
4242

tests/test_09_jwt.py

Lines changed: 3 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2,14 +2,11 @@
22

33
import pytest
44

5-
from cryptojwt.exception import IssuerNotFound
6-
from cryptojwt.exception import JWKESTException
5+
from cryptojwt.exception import IssuerNotFound, JWKESTException
76
from cryptojwt.jws.exception import NoSuitableSigningKeys
8-
from cryptojwt.jwt import JWT
9-
from cryptojwt.jwt import pick_key
7+
from cryptojwt.jwt import JWT, pick_key
108
from cryptojwt.key_bundle import KeyBundle
11-
from cryptojwt.key_jar import KeyJar
12-
from cryptojwt.key_jar import init_key_jar
9+
from cryptojwt.key_jar import KeyJar, init_key_jar
1310

1411
__author__ = "Roland Hedberg"
1512

tests/test_10_jwk_wrap.py

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-3,8 +3,7 @@
33
from cryptojwt.jwk.ec import new_ec_key
44
from cryptojwt.jwk.hmac import SYMKey
55
from cryptojwt.jwk.rsa import new_rsa_key
6-
from cryptojwt.jwk.wrap import unwrap_key
7-
from cryptojwt.jwk.wrap import wrap_key
6+
from cryptojwt.jwk.wrap import unwrap_key, wrap_key
87

98
__author__ = "jschlyter"
109

0 commit comments

Comments
 (0)